How to replicate a sent quote?

There is an option to replicate, extend and negotiate a quote that has been sent

Last updated on 07 May, 2024

Once the quote is sent, it is not possible to do any changes to it - it has been recorded in the client's history. But it is possible to:

1) REPLICATE a quote = keep the same margins

When selecting this option, Quotiss will pick the latest updated contract rates from the system, re-applying the previously selected margins and adjusting the totals accordingly.

2) EXTEND a quote = keep the same totals

When selecting this option, Quotiss will pick the latest updated contract rates from the system, re-applying the previously calculated total and adjusting the margins accordingly.

3) NEGOTIATE a quote = keep same quote ID

This is a new option, designed for the cases when you wish to keep the same quote ID. Negotiated quotes will not be counted on the Dashboard as new quotes, will have 'Negotiated' status, and will be linked to the 'mother' quote. 

To replicate, extend or negotiate a quote, please select a quote that has been sent and open it. All elements in the quote will be blocked for editing.

Image

Click on the respective button, and the elements will unlock. The previous rate level will apply. You can change any of the parameters and follow the usual steps to send a new quote.
